Optimization and repeatability of multipool chemical exchange saturation transfer MRI of the prostate at 3.0 T

Abstract: Background Chemical exchange saturation transfer (CEST) can potentially support cancer imaging with metabolically derived information. Multiparametric prostate MRI has improved diagnosis but may benefit from additional information to reduce the need for biopsies. Purpose To optimize an acquisition and postprocessing protocol for 3.0 T multipool CEST analysis of prostate data and evaluate the repeatability of the technique. Study Type Prospective.
